Raines Tavern
Hamlet
Raines Tavern is an unincorporated community in Cumberland County on Virginia State Route 45 just north of Farmville in the U.S. state of Virginia. It was a stop on the Farmville and Powhatan Railroad from 1884 to 1905, and on the Tidewater and Western Railroad from 1905 to 1917. Raines Tavern is situated 3 miles northeast of Friedman Cemetery.
